Hi Richard,
* Richard Bos wrote on Sun, Nov 13, 2005 at 12:00:16AM CET:
> Problem: a variable remains undefined during 'make distcheck',
> although, it is present in the file that is included by Makefile.am.
*snip*
>
> The file dist_conf/kolab (@distribution@) included by configure.ac as follows:
> AC_ARG_ENABLE([dist],
> [AC_HELP_STRING([--enable-dist=DIST],
> [distribution target (default: openpkg)])],
> [distribution=dist_conf/$enable_dist],
> [distribution=dist_conf/kolab])
> AC_SUBST_FILE(distribution)
Shot in the dark: Maybe you want
distribution=$srcdir/dist_conf/kolab
instead? If you do VPATH builds (source tree != build tree), you should
encounter the problem there as well.
If this was wrong, please provide autoconf and automake versions.
